Just another finding; Id forget the Amazon Market as an ad-sales venue. I tried a couple of apps on there last month. I took apps that make a combined $140 per week on Google Play and placed them on the Amazon app market. After a week, the combined income on Amazon was 6c. Yes, 6c! I didn’t think it was possible to create a market with less revenue return than Windows Phone but somehow Amazon has done just that.

Stick with Google Play, its the only game in town. :slight_smile:

Can someone with experience of working with Amazon Store and Samsung Compare Compare with Google Play? Are we looking at 1:10 , 1:100 ratio’s ?

I have apps on both amazon and GP. GP out performs 500:1 - Amazon for ad-revenue is terrible with extremely low fill-rate (approx 60% for me) and once you list a free app, you cant de-list it. I initially put all my apps on Amazon, found there is no ad-revenue and now they are stuck on there and cant be taken off - for free with low fill-rate. So I then made ‘paid’ versions and sold around 15 copies. The 15 sales strangely disappeared with no explanation on my Amazon ‘payment’ tab and all they claim they owe me is 33c -for 15 app sales and 3 months of ad revenue. The total should be closer to $20 - not much, but still, its $20 and not 33c.

Forget Amazon - don’t waste your time.

You need to use mediation or your own ads loading with backup to combat the low fill rate. You can use admob ads on apps submitted to amazon, so you don’t neccessarily have to have low fillrate. What I do is load an Amazon ad and an AdMob ad at yhe same time. If yhe Amazon ad doesnt fill I show the AdMob ad. You can also use Amazon ads in your apps on Google Play. The fillrate may be low, but yhe ecpm is usually very high, so it’s worth it if you use them with mediation or a backup.
